Anmerkung
Der Zugriff auf diese Seite erfordert eine Genehmigung. Du kannst versuchen, dich anzumelden oder die Verzeichnisse zu wechseln.
Der Zugriff auf diese Seite erfordert eine Genehmigung. Du kannst versuchen , die Verzeichnisse zu wechseln.
Eine anwendungsdefinierte Rückruffunktion, die WM_TIMER Nachrichten verarbeitet. Der TIMERPROC-Typ definiert einen Zeiger auf diese Rückruffunktion. TimerProc ist ein Platzhalter für den anwendungsdefinierte Funktionsnamen.
Syntax
TIMERPROC Timerproc;
VOID Timerproc(
HWND unnamedParam1,
UINT unnamedParam2,
UINT_PTR unnamedParam3,
DWORD unnamedParam4
)
{...}
Die Parameter
unnamedParam1
Typ: HWND-
Ein Handle für das Fenster, das dem Timer zugeordnet ist. Dieser Parameter wird in der Regel hWnd genannt.
unnamedParam2
Typ: UINT
Die WM_TIMER Nachricht. Dieser Parameter wird in der Regel als uMsg bezeichnet.
unnamedParam3
Typ: UINT_PTR
Der Bezeichner des Zeitgebers. Dieser Parameter heißt in der Regel "idEvent".
unnamedParam4
Typ: DWORD-
Die Anzahl der Millisekunden, die seit dem Start des Systems verstrichen sind. Dies ist der von der GetTickCount-Funktion zurückgegebene Wert. Dieser Parameter wird in der Regel dwTime genannt.
Rückgabewert
Nichts
Bemerkungen
Hinweis
Die Parameter werden in der Kopfzeile ohne Namen definiert: typedef VOID (CALLBACK* TIMERPROC)(HWND, UINT, UINT_PTR, DWORD);. Der Syntaxblock listet sie daher als unnamedParam1 - unnamedParam4. Sie können diese Parameter in Ihrer App benennen. Sie werden jedoch in der Regel wie in den Parameterbeschreibungen dargestellt benannt.
Anforderungen
| Anforderung | Wert |
|---|---|
| Mindestens unterstützter Client | Windows 2000 Professional [nur Desktop-Apps] |
| Mindestanforderungen für unterstützte Server | Windows 2000 Server [nur Desktop-Apps] |
| Zielplattform | Fenster |
| Header | winuser.h (enthalten Windows.h) |
Siehe auch
Konzeptionell
Referenz